Why do we need leadership? The leadership is necessary for corporate survival How many years is been P & G for existence ? – 182 years It`s America based company Characteristics of effective leaders? – leading oneself before leading others ; they know where they are going ; … Ineffective leaders – incompetence, it`s all about me; lack of communication with the team ; unemotional intelligence ; … Far more important then what you do is – who you are!

Leadership character What is character ? – personality, values, it is : Who you are, when no one is watching !!! 1) Sense of purpose – the reason for being; Motivation; from deep within - internal 2) Courage – the 1 st of personal qualities, the one that guaranties all others 3) Self discipline – who decides what the right thing is – he uses the Bible 4) Respect – excepting differences in others 5) Integrity – someone who is known for deep, honesty and integrity : Who you are when no one is watching! 6) Humility – it`s all about their ego – the ineffective leaders 7) Empathy / Compassion – challenge people to take significant things

The Leadership Actions What Leaders DO ? – 5 point model ( principles that P&G uses ) 1) The idea of laying out a Vision - visionaire 2) The idea of engaging others – vision of the future – to develop leaderships with other people 3) Adding Capability people to have the skills that they need 4) Driving inspiration – the leadership role of the inspirer – giving energy, motivation ! 5) Executing with excellence / If you practice them, you are guaranteed to be an effective leader /

1) Laying out a Vision - Visionaire Steve Jobs, Da Vinci, John F. Kennedy, Martin Luther King – charismatic, inspiring, creative – they saw something, they connected the points. Someone who is externally focused! Creative, involving others to take that vision to the next level 2) Engaging others : Mother Theresa A person who build strong relationship, TRUST ! Number 1 motivation in the world is Selfinterest

3) Capability – Martin Luther King, … Role of the leader – doing what you do best. / His job is to build capability in the global world, to develop them as leaders / The people in the team to know their strengths – Annual performance review : If you do A, B, C well, others would tell you focus on X,Y,Z, but P & G : what we can do to do A,B,C even better? We are going to have passion, better results Re-modeling / Are you an above average, compared with other people ? 94% men/

4) Inspiration – John F. Kennedy, Mother Theresa Someone who shows enthusiasm, internal motivation P & G wants people to understand how their work connects to the purpose of the company. Recognition 5) Executing with excellence – general strategies The role of the manager: Accountability ( systems put in the place ), making sure all the people that are following you understand how their role relates to the role of the organization. The idea of personally showing that you can lead by example. Leader is not someone that stays around and supervises, but someone who gets his hands dirty and does things. * Write down 1 or 2 things that you do especially well and that you could still improve the most on

Leadership Emotional Intelligence Why this matters to P & G ? – It`s a way to understand who will be leaders ! Those who have strong emotional intelligence. - IQ is max developed by the age of 25 ( running out of time ) - EQ – we can develop all the time ( P&G emphasises on EQ ) Intelligence = … + … + … ( musical, interpersonal, ….. ) IQ – people know it, but EQ matters more, because 85% of successful leaders are successful because of EQ and 15% because of IQ !!! “IQ gets you to the door, but EQ gets you hired” 5 Indicators of high potential – a person who practices these 5 actions is an effective human being ( the 5 actions )

4 Elements: 1) Self awareness – the idea of recognizing ones moves, emotions and drives. ( optimistic, balanced people, who know themselves ) What is your Hot bottom ? What is the response that other people give in that emotional react? Self confident – someone who is willing to talk about what he does; people who are not just receiving feedback, but go and ask for it! 2) Self management – people who are really focused on getting things done – internally motivated; responding to emotional situations; We are emotional ( the people being ) The ability to make choices Ex. With Nelson Mandela – 27 years in jail for unfair reason

4 Elements: 3) Social awareness – The idea is to understand the emotions that we see around and to respond in a positive way ( somebody was really good in listening with his eyes ) Creating relationships ( he isn`t trying to do everybody like you or everybody happy ) 4) Social management – managing relationships, networking, people who are really good with social skills In every organization CHANGE is very important word!
